About Me
Building Intelligent Industrial Automation Solutions
I am a Robotics & Automation Engineer with nearly four years of experience delivering industrial automation solutions from concept to customer acceptance. I have programmed, commissioned and integrated robotic systems using ABB, KUKA, FANUC, Yaskawa, Kawasaki, Mitsubishi, Epson, Elite and OTC Daihen robots across aerospace, automotive, electronics, FMCG and paint industries. My expertise includes robot programming, PLC integration, industrial communication protocols, offline simulation, virtual commissioning and production optimisation.

Aerospace & Defence Robotic Drilling
Industry
Aerospace Manufacturing
Customer
Tata Lockheed Martin
Project Details
High-precision robotic drilling solution developed for aerospace manufacturing. The project included offline simulation, reachability analysis, drilling path generation, PLC and HMI development, project planning, commissioning, and onsite technical leadership to ensure accurate and reliable production.

Arc Welding Cell with Seam Tracking
Industry
Heavy Fabrication & Welding Automation
Customer
Stelmac
Project Details
Automated robotic arc welding cell integrated with seam tracking technology for accurate weld path correction. The system continuously compensated for joint deviations and welding gaps, ensuring consistent weld quality and reliable production performance.
